Welcome 微信登录

首页 / 软件开发 / .NET编程技术

为什么叫.NET

为什么叫.NET

为什么叫.NET2016-01-31微软最初是在上世纪九十年代末开始开发.NET,最初.NET还不是叫作.NET,而是“NextGenerationWindowsServices”(NGWS)。那微软又为什么给它改名叫做.NET呢?这个奇怪的名字甚至非常不方便搜索引擎来索引。微软为什么会改名本身就是一个谜,下面是我收集的最可靠的答案:.NET让微软的销售人员首次可以向大众宣布自己也拥有了自己的网络技术,当然也是为了对抗当时宣称&ld...
胡乱理解ADO.NET(一)

胡乱理解ADO.NET(一)

胡乱理解ADO.NET(一)2010-07-13 cnblogs hssl严重注意:下述内容可能完全错误,我只是乱理解一翻便于自己记忆。不能作为任何网友的参考,那便是严重误人子弟了!希望有懂的人看到后能告诉我真正的原理。谢谢!对数据库的操作貌似是程序员必须要掌握的知识,也是绝大部分的项目中要用到的知识。在.net框架下程序与数据库之间的互操作称为:ADO.NET。也做过一些项目,对于程序与数据库的操作,也会用。不明白的地方上网搜一下,查查资料,再把高手写的...
胡乱理解ADO.NET(二)

胡乱理解ADO.NET(二)

胡乱理解ADO.NET(二)2010-07-13 cnblogs hssl在上篇文章中说了程序对数据库的操作后,我们通常要返回操作信息.例如:返回受影响的行数或者返回查询的数据.SqlDataReader可以对返回的数据进行操作,但只是只读的,而且必须要保持连接才行.那么能不能更灵活的对返回的数据操作呢?答案是肯定的.既然我要对返回的数据进行灵活的操作,那么我们是不是要搞个东西来存放这些数据.要不然程序得到数据库里的数据后放哪?我们用什么来存放这些数据呢?...
胡乱理解ADO.NET(四)

胡乱理解ADO.NET(四)

胡乱理解ADO.NET(四)2010-07-13 cnblogs hssl在上两篇文章中,对于dataset做了个简单的探讨.很多次提到,可以把dataset看作是内存中的数据库.既然是数据库,那么首要任务就是存储数据用的.而之前,我所举的的例子都是手工往dataset里添加数据,其实这个并不是我们最想要的.我们最想要的是能用程序把数据库里的数据读取出来然后装到dataset里,然后用程序来处理dataset里的数据.当处理好dataset里的数据后,我们...
ADO.NET Entity Framework深入分析,Part 6–处理并发(Concurrency Handling)

ADO.NET Entity Framework深入分析,Part 6–处理并发(Concurrency Handling)

ADO.NET Entity Framework深入分析,Part 6–处理并发(Concurrency Handling)2010-09-10EntLib设置并发模式Entity Framework 实现了乐观的并发模式(Optimistic Concurrency Model)。默认情况下,在实体更新数据提交到数据库时,并不会检查并发。对于高频率的并发属性,你需要设置属性的并发模式为Fixed。这些属性将会加入到T-SQL脚本的WHERE子句部分,用来...
用多活动结果集优化ADO.NET2.0数据连接

用多活动结果集优化ADO.NET2.0数据连接

用多活动结果集优化ADO.NET2.0数据连接2010-09-24阅读概要 欢迎参予讨论MARS的使用!通过这里介绍的MARS技术上,你能够在单个连接上执行多重数据库查询。而且依赖于MARS技术的编码更为简单易读,并且使你在开发数据集中的Web应用程序时可以减少内存使用并在一定程序上消除性能瓶颈。难道你不想尝试一下MARS?多活动结果集(Multiple Active Result Sets,简称MARS)是ADO.NET 2.0的一个新特征-它允许在单个...
使用ADO.NET的最佳实践

使用ADO.NET的最佳实践

使用ADO.NET的最佳实践2010-09-24 Dennis Lu Doug Rotha ADO.NET作为微软最新的数据访问技术,已经在企业开发中得到了广泛的应用。对于一线的开发人员来说,掌握基本的概念和技术之后,提高应用水平和解决实际问题的最有效手段,莫过于相互交流彼此的最佳时间经验经验。在这篇文章中,两位ADO.NET专家向读者毫无保留地、详尽地介绍了很多实用经验。简介本文为您提供了在Microsoft ADO.NET应用程序中实现和获得最佳性能、...
<< 141 142 143 144 145 146 147 148 149 150 >>